Research profile

University of Malawi has published 8,128 scientific papers with 202,186 citations received. The research profile covers a range of fields, including Medicine, Biology, Liberal Arts & Social Sciences, Environmental Science, Pathology, Sociology, Political Science, Law, Economics, and Public Health.

10 Notable alumni

Sosten Gwengwe

1. Sosten Gwengwe

1977-. (aged 49)
politician
Sosten Gwengwe is a Malawian politician who served as the Minister of Finance and Economic Affairs of the Republic of Malawi from January 30, 2022 until his replacement in October 2023. He previously served as Minister of Trade from June 2020 until his appointment as Finance and Economic Affairs Minister.

Felix Mlusu

3. Felix Mlusu

1951-. (aged 75)
Felix Mlusu is a Malawian corporate executive who served as the 22nd Minister of Finance in the Government of the Republic of Malawi from 2020 to 2022. Prior to his role in the Treasury he was Managing Director and Group Chief Executive Officer of NICO Holdings from 1994 until his retirement on 31 December 2016.

Ken Lipenga

4. Ken Lipenga

1952-. (aged 74)
politician minister
Ken Diston Lipenga is a Malawian politician, journalist, and writer. He was the Member of Parliament for Phalombe East from 1997 to 2014. He has served in various ministerial positions.
